Frequently asked questions

How often do Solomon Islands and United States vote together at the UN?

Solomon Islands and United States voted the same way in 23.3% of 3,132 shared UN General Assembly votes since 1946.

Do Solomon Islands and United States agree on human rights votes?

On human rights resolutions, Solomon Islands and United States mostly disagree: they voted the same way in 23.2% of 630 shared human-rights votes at the UN General Assembly.

When did Solomon Islands and United States last disagree at the UN?

Among their biggest recent splits, on 2017-12-04 Solomon Islands voted "yes" and United States voted "no" on A/RES/72/31 (Taking forward multilateral nuclear disarmament negotiations : resolution / adopted by the General Assembly).
